Hatch on Secretary Geithner Saying White House Willing to Go Over Fiscal Cliff

Statement

Date: Dec. 5, 2012

U.S. Senator Orrin Hatch (R-Utah), Ranking Member of the Senate Finance Committee, issued the following statement after Treasury Secretary Tim Geithner said the White House is willing to go over the fiscal cliff over the top two marginal tax rates:

"This is one of the most stunning and irresponsible statements I've heard in some time. Going over the fiscal cliff will put our economy, jobs, people's paychecks and retirement at risk, but that is what the White House wants, according to Secretary Geithner, if they don't get their way. The American people want us to find a reasonable path forward -- not to rattle our sabers and play this dangerous game that will impact the lives of nearly every single American. It's time for some real leadership from the President. Instead of threatening to take America over the cliff, it's time for the White House to come to the table in a meaningful way."
